Emergency Services in Hat Yai, Thailand

1. Police Services

  • Contact Number: Dial 191 for emergency police assistance.

2. Fire Services

  • Contact Number: Dial 199 for fire emergencies.

3. Medical Services

  • Emergency Medical Services (EMS):
    • Contact Number: Dial 1669 for ambulance services.

  • Procedure: Call 1669 for an ambulance. If you can, provide details about the patientโ€™s condition and location. If you go to a hospital, bring identification and any medical records if available.
  • Costs: Emergency services may incur costs, especially for non-residents. Itโ€™s advisable to have travel insurance that covers medical emergencies. Payment may be required upfront in some private hospitals.
  • Cultural Considerations: Thai healthcare professionals are generally very respectful and attentive. Itโ€™s important to communicate clearly about your medical needs. If language is a barrier, having a translation app or a local friend can be helpful.

Additional Considerations

  • Language: While many emergency personnel may speak basic English, itโ€™s beneficial to learn a few key Thai phrases or have a translation app handy.
  • Local Customs: Always show respect to emergency personnel. A polite demeanor can facilitate better communication and assistance.
  • Safety Tips: Familiarize yourself with the local area, including the nearest hospitals and police stations. Keep emergency contact numbers saved on your phone.
